Yellow Lentil Stew

2 T olive oil
3 cloves garlic, minced
2 c yellow lentils, sorted and rinsed
4 c vegetable broth
1 T fresh minced ginger
Grated peel from one lemon (yellow part only)
1/4 c lemon juice
Salt and pepper to taste

Chopped cilantro and lemon wedges for garnish

Heat olive oil in a large sauce pan. Saute garlic for one minute. Add lentils and stir. Add broth.

Simmer until lentils are tender, approximately 25 minutes.

Stir in ginger, lemon peel, lemon juice, salt and pepper.

Serve with cilantro and lemon wedges.
